CureVac N.V. (NASDAQ: CVAC) is a multinational biopharmaceutical and biotech company focused on medicines based on messenger RNA (mRNA). Founded in 2000 and headquartered in Tübingen, Germany, CureVac describes itself as a pioneer in mRNA technology, with more than two decades of experience in developing, optimizing, and manufacturing mRNA for medical use. Its public communications highlight work in oncology precision immunotherapies, prophylactic vaccines, and mRNA-based treatments that aim to enable the body to produce therapeutic proteins.
The CVAC news feed features company announcements on clinical development milestones, regulatory decisions, intellectual property rulings, and financial results. Examples include updates on Phase 1 studies for off-the-shelf precision immunotherapies in glioblastoma and squamous non-small cell lung cancer, progress in a urinary tract infection vaccine program, and regulatory clearances such as U.S. FDA Investigational New Drug approvals and European Medicines Agency Clinical Trial Application decisions.
Investors and observers will also find news on patent litigation and IP protection, particularly proceedings at the European Patent Office and German courts involving patents that describe split poly-A tail technology, as well as agreements with BioNTech and Pfizer regarding mRNA-based COVID-19 vaccines. In addition, CureVac regularly reports quarterly and annual financial results, cash position, and the effects of restructuring and licensing agreements with partners like GSK and CRISPR Therapeutics.
Recent releases describe a definitive purchase agreement under which BioNTech intends to acquire all shares of CureVac via a public exchange offer, along with shareholder voting results and steps toward a post-offer reorganization.
